Gen Z Student Scores 93% in Boards, Slams BJP Post

A recent social media post by the BJP Chhattisgarh unit sparked controversy when it contrasted two different mindsets of Gen Z using a video of a dancer. However, the dancer in question, Urwashi Palandurkar, was not pleased with the party using her footage without permission.

Palandurkar, who scored an impressive 93% in her board exams, responded to the post with a sarcastic rebuttal that quickly went viral. In her reaction video, she highlighted her academic achievements as well as her extracurricular activities, including dancing. She defended her right to dance in public, stating that academics and art can coexist.

The BJP post had attempted to portray two different types of Gen Z mindsets, implying that one was more desirable than the other. However, Palandurkar's response turned the tables on the party, showcasing her own achievements and challenging the notion that one cannot excel in both academics and the arts.

Palandurkar's video gained significant traction on social media, with many users praising her for standing up for herself and defending her passions. The video was also shared by several political leaders, who applauded her confidence and achievements.
